taste aversions are learned through classical conditioning. match each example to its corresponding stimulus or response.
Julli [10]

By matching each example to its corresponding stimulus or response, we have the following:

Unconditioned Response: vomiting;

  • This is a condition or actions that occur without learning it. It is inborn.

Unconditioned Stimulus: food poisoning;

  • This is a form of stimulus that results in a natural reaction without forcing it or intentionally doing it.

Conditioned Response: refusal to eat;

  • This is a type of response that is learned. It is intentionally done by the subject.

Conditioned Stimulus: a taste of the chicken salad

  • This is often considered a neutral stimulus initially but later turns to a learned response over time.
